House Republicans and Democrats backed President Barack Obama’s request to train and equip Syrian rebels in a measure that both parties stressed doesn’t authorize a U.S. ground war to defeat Islamic militants.

In a 273-156 vote, the Republican-led chamber agreed to add the proposal to a must-pass bill to finance the government through Dec. 11. The House will vote soon on passage of the spending bill.
